The effects of GATA4‐S105A overexpression by intramyocardial gene delivery after myocardial infarction in rats. (A) RT‐qPCR quantification of GATA4 mRNA levels in LVs of sham‐operated and MI animals at 3 d, 1 and 2 wks. The values were normalized to GAPDH and are expressed as relative to sham LacZ control groups at each time point. The bars represent average values + SD (n = 5‐8/group). * P ≤ .05, ** P ≤ .01, *** P ≤ .005 Sham GATA4‐S105A compared to LacZ group and # P ≤ .05 MI GATA4‐S105A compared to LacZ. (B‐E) Echocardiographic measurements were performed at 2 wks after infarction and gene transfer. LVEF = left ventricular ejection fraction; LVFS = left ventricular fractional shortening; LVPW = left ventricular posterior wall thickness; LVID = left ventricular internal diameter. (F‐I) Immunohistochemistry studies for apoptosis (TUNEL, F), c‐kit‐positive cells (G), fibrosis (Masson's trichrome, H) and angiogenesis (vWF, I) from LV histological sections at 2 wks after MI and injection of the adenoviral constructs. (J) The infarct area was measured from 3 d and 2 wks histological LV sections stained with Masson's trichrome. The results are represented as average ± SD (n = 5‐8/group)
